Output 682100f8ea7303151c2536a663910292c651afba7e3bf7352d8fb56008f952d7:4

value
74094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034b573a03d676bca385b1dcdb6d9178e86eb4ba OP_EQUAL
address
31zSCtGwnes79a5DPcan5QKFacW3LMmwVT
transaction
682100f8ea7303151c2536a663910292c651afba7e3bf7352d8fb56008f952d7
spent
true